Equity and Inclusion

Gender equity and inclusion is a cross-cutting theme in the Global Data Barometer.

In each component, and within each theme, we explore the extent to which rules, capacities, data, and use respect and reflect gender equity and the needs and rights of commonly excluded groups.

Data can also be used to address specific gender and inclusion-related issues, including gender-based violence, gender-based pay gaps, and accessibility.
